如果在使用ifconfig命令时没有显示IP地址,可能是由于以下几个原因导致的:
1. 网络接口未激活:有些网络接口在系统启动时并不会自动激活,因此在使用ifconfig命令时可能会出现没有显示IP地址的情况。可以通过使用ifconfig命令手动激活网络接口来解决这个问题。例如,可以使用以下命令激活eth0网络接口:
```
sudo ifconfig eth0 up
```
2. IP地址未分配:另一个可能的原因是未为相应的网络接口分配IP地址。可以通过手动为网络接口分配IP地址来解决这个问题。例如,可以使用以下命令为eth0网络接口分配IP地址:
```
sudo ifconfig eth0 192.168.1.100
```
3. 网络配置问题:有时候网络配置文件中的配置可能出现问题,导致使用ifconfig命令时无法显示IP地址。可以通过检查网络配置文件,并根据需要进行修改来解决此问题。网络配置文件通常位于/etc/network/interfaces目录中。
4. 网络故障:最后,如果以上方法均无效,那么可能是由于网络硬件故障所致。可以尝试重启网络服务或者重启系统来解决这个问题。
总的来说,如果在使用ifconfig命令时没有显示IP地址,首先应该检查网络接口是否已激活,并且是否已分配IP地址。如果以上方法都无效,那么可能是由于网络配置问题或网络硬件故障所致,需要进一步排查并解决。希望以上信息能帮助你解决Linux系统中ifconfig命令没有显示IP地址的问题。